Supplier Technical Teams: The Most Underused Asset in Waterproofing Projects

In waterproofing projects, deadlines and budgets often take priority - but one of the most overlooked resources is the supplier’s technical team. These experts are more than product specialists; they can prevent mistakes, reduce costs, and keep projects on track.

Why Supplier Technical Teams Matter

Many contractors focus solely on material supply, missing the chance to leverage supplier expertise. Technical teams provide:

  • Product installation guidance for complex substrates

  • Solutions for site-specific waterproofing challenges

  • Advice to maintain compliance and warranty coverage

  • Tips on compatibility between membranes, sealants, and coatings

Real-World Example
A rooftop deck waterproofing job faced repeated ponding issues. By involving the supplier’s technical team early, the team implemented a solution that saved labor, prevented leaks, and preserved the warranty. Early consultation avoids costly rework.

How to Maximise Their Value

  1. Engage Early: Invite them to design reviews and tender clarifications.

  2. Site Visits: On-site technical support identifies potential issues before they escalate.

  3. Document Guidance: Record advice to maintain warranty compliance.

  4. Build Strong Relationships: Reliable access ensures fast, effective solutions.

The Takeaway
Supplier technical teams are a hidden asset in waterproofing projects. Using their expertise proactively reduces mistakes, saves time, and ensures compliant, durable installations - yet many projects still overlook this resource.
